Been to the Cosmo Hotel & Casino a ton of times and my typical go-to drink is the Cosmo (amazing, if you haven't tried it yet). At the Chandler Bar though, I opted to try the hyped up Verbena cocktail. And it was most certainly memorable!
I was instructed by the friendly bartender to take an initial sip of the drink, then chew up the Szechuan flower (at least 10 seconds, and make sure you get it all around your mouth), then swallow the flower bits (including the stem). The effects of the flower is almost immediate and it almost feels like tiny little bubbles all over our tongue and mouth. Kind of like champagne or pop rocks. When you take a second sip of the Verbena, it's a totally different mouth feel. Almost spicy-like, with everything that's bubbling in your mouth. It was quite the unique experience. I'd recommend taking a sip of water also, as that tastes different as well.
